There are many. Mozzarella, Cheddar, Gruyere and Fontina just to name a few. Almost any hard cheese would work and most soft cheeses as long as there is no rind / you chop it off first.

What is spaghetti pie?

A spaghetti pie is a pie with crust made from spaghetti. Cooked spaghetti is mixed with eggs and pressed into a pie plate. It is filled with sauce, cheese, meat and other toppings and then baked. It is a dish often employed to use up leftover spaghetti.


What is a spaghetti bake?

Spaghetti Bake is typically spaghetti prepared as usual and baked with extra cheese. Below is a great recipe: Ingredients: 1 16-ounce pkg. spaghetti 1 pound ground beef 1 medium onion, chopped 1 24-ounce jar spaghetti sauce 1/2 teaspoon seasoned salt 2 eggs 1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ese 5 tablespoons butter, melted 2 cups cottage cheese 4 cups shredded mozzarella cheese Directions: Cook spaghetti according to directions on package. Meanwhile, cook beef and onion over medium heat until meat is no longer pink. Drain. Stir in spaghetti sauce and seasoned salt. Set aside. In a large bowl, whisk the eggs, Parmesan cheese and butter together. Drain spaghetti. Add to egg mixture and toss to coat well. Place half of the spaghetti mixture in a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king dish. Top with half of the cottage cheese, sauce and mozzarella cheese. Repeat layers. Cover and bake at 350° for 40 minutes. Uncover; bake 20-25 minutes longer or until cheese is melted.
